The Railways and Other Guided Transport Systems (Safety) Regulations 2006

The Railways and Other Guided Transport Systems (Safety) Regulations 2006 reg 22

reg 22 Co-operation

(1) Every person to whom this paragraph applies shall co-operate as far as is necessary with a transport operator to enable him to comply with the provisions of these Regulations. (2) Paragraph (1) applies to— (a) any transport operator whose operations may affect or may be affected by operations carried out by the duty holder; and (b) an employer of persons or a self-employed person carrying out work on or in relation to premises or plant owned or controlled by the duty holder. (3) Every transport operator shall co-operate, insofar as is reasonable, with any other transport operator who operates on the same transport system where that other transport operator is taking action to achieve the safe operation of that transport system. (4) In paragraph (2) “ duty holder ” means a transport operator referred to in paragraph (1).
